Core Capabilities
Single-mode fiber (SMF)
Long-distance, high-bandwidth runs for inter-building, campus, and outside plant applications — supporting 10G to 100G+ speeds over extended distances.
Multimode fiber (MMF)
Cost-effective short-distance runs within buildings and data centers — supporting high-speed LAN backbones, switch-to-switch, and switch-to-server links.
Outside plant (OSP) fiber
Aerial and underground fiber deployment between buildings and across campuses — including directional drilling, conduit work, and vault installations.
Fusion splicing
Precision fusion splicing for low-loss, permanent fiber connections — performed by certified technicians with OTDR testing and documentation on every splice.
OTDR testing & certification
Full end-to-end testing with OTDR equipment — identifying faults, verifying loss budgets, and producing certified documentation for every run.
Fiber distribution & patching
High-density fiber distribution frames (FDF), patch panels, enclosures, and cable management — organized, labeled, and documented for clean, maintainable infrastructure.

Standards-Based From The Ground Up
Every fiber installation we deliver is engineered and tested to recognized industry standards — including TIA/EIA-568, TIA-598, and ISO/IEC 11801 — ensuring compatibility with current and future network equipment, and giving you documentation that satisfies both internal governance and external audit requirements.
Our technicians hold current BICSI and manufacturer certifications, and all test results are delivered in structured reports that accompany the project as-built package — so you know exactly what was installed, where, and how it performs.
